In today's fast-paced legal landscape, productivity is paramount. To achieve this goal, many law firms are Staff Automation utilizing case tracking systems that leverage staff automation to streamline legal proceedings. These systems consolidate case information, automate routine tasks, and provide real-time updates, thereby enhancing the overall workflow. By automating repetitive processes such as document management, scheduling, and client communication, staff can devote their time on more complex legal tasks.

This increased automation not only saves valuable time but also decreases the risk of human error, ensuring greater accuracy and compliance with legal regulations. Moreover, these systems provide comprehensive reporting capabilities, offering invaluable insights into case progress, resource allocation, and performance.

Through the strategic implementation of staff automation in case tracking systems, law firms can enhance their operations, streamline legal proceedings, and ultimately provide a more efficient service to their clients.

Automating Financial Services: Enhancing Efficiency and Accuracy Through Process Orchestration

The financial services industry steadily faces pressure to improve efficiency and accuracy while minimizing costs. Automation offers a powerful solution, enabling institutions to enhance complex processes and deliver faster service. Process orchestration, a key component of automation, manages the execution of diverse tasks in a predefined order, ensuring seamless workflow and lowered human intervention.

Through process orchestration, financial institutions can attain significant gains. This includes improved accuracy by minimizing manual data entry errors, heightened processing speeds, and reduced operational costs. Furthermore, process orchestration empowers institutions to adjust operations adaptably to meet dynamic customer demands.

  • Increased Accuracy: By automating tasks and minimizing manual intervention, process orchestration helps to decrease errors and improve the overall accuracy of financial transactions.
  • Quickened Processing Speeds: Process orchestration can significantly speed up the time it takes to complete complex financial processes, leading to faster service delivery and increased customer satisfaction.
  • Lowered Operational Costs: Automation through process orchestration can enhance workflows, reduce redundant tasks, and free up human resources for more strategic initiatives, ultimately leading to cost savings.

Aligning Financial Operations: Integrating Automation for Enhanced Compliance Monitoring

In today's dynamic financial landscape, organizations face increasing pressure to ensure robust compliance monitoring. To effectively mitigate risks and maintain regulatory adherence, aligning financial operations with automated solutions is crucial. By integrating automation throughout key processes, businesses can streamline workflows, enhance data accuracy, and significantly improve the efficiency of compliance monitoring efforts. Additionally, automation empowers organizations to proactively identify potential non-compliances and take swift corrective actions, minimizing the impact of financial transgressions.

  • Leveraging robotic process automation (RPA) can automate repetitive tasks such as data entry, reconciliation, and report generation, freeing up valuable time for finance professionals to focus on more strategic initiatives.
  • Advanced analytics tools can be embedded into automation workflows to identify patterns and anomalies in financial transactions, providing early indications of potential compliance issues.
  • Instantaneous monitoring capabilities enable organizations to track key performance indicators (KPIs) and maintain ongoing compliance with regulatory requirements.
